Lost Miracle’s aesthetic is rooted in a fluid merger of deep techno, progressive house, and tech house, favouring expansive, melody-led structures and restrained, hypnotic energy over blunt force. With a Ninja average of 8.1 across seven current cuts, the imprint’s quality control is unmistakable; Sébastien Léger, Khen, Volen Sentir, Makebo, and Lost Miracle all trade in sleek, emotive electronics that prize patience and subtle modulation.
In the underground landscape, the label sits comfortably in the melodic mid-ground between driving tech house and deeper progressive realms, avoiding mainstream bombast while retaining genuine dance floor utility. Its output slots neatly into sets that favour sustained groove and atmospheric detail, cementing Lost Miracle as a dependable source for sophisticated, forward-facing house and techno.
